Variations in Diamond Settings: Numbers, Bezels, and More
The term "Rolex Datejust 41 mit Diamanten" encompasses a range of variations in diamond settings. The most common configurations include:
* Diamond-set hour markers (diamond numbers): This is perhaps the most popular option, where the hour markers on the dial are replaced with individually set diamonds. The size and quality of these diamonds can vary, influencing the overall price. Variations exist in the style of setting, with some models featuring more prominent, bezel-set diamonds, while others opt for smaller, more subtly integrated stones.
* Diamond bezel: Some Datejust 41 models feature a diamond-set bezel, adding another layer of sparkle to the watch. The number of diamonds and their setting style contribute to the overall visual impact and price.
* Diamond-set dial: While less common, some highly exclusive variations feature a diamond-set dial, with diamonds adorning not only the hour markers but also other areas of the dial's surface. These models represent the pinnacle of luxury and command significantly higher prices.
* Combinations: Many models combine diamond-set hour markers with a diamond bezel, creating a truly opulent and dazzling timepiece.
